Transaction 368d655dde9dec9130e14de60671875705f10bb2dd238be1c92979b83b80b4e7
1 Input
1 Output
-
368d655dde9dec9130e14de60671875705f10bb2dd238be1c92979b83b80b4e7:0
- value
- 2128602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ae24ec8b54689f7f7bba920aaab500e325b0b12 OP_EQUAL
- address
- 3CtmU5tsbPxBANxEunDk9uXERzXFQDrmyP